Ann Applewhite



Ann Applewhite, age 50, of New York City, formerly of Randolph, NJ, died November 5, 2008 at Chilton Memorial Hospital in Pompton Plains, N.J. A private burial service will be held at a later date.

Born in Queens, New York, Ms. Applewhite lived in Randolph before moving to New York City 25 years ago.

A graduate of Fairleigh Dickinson Univeristy, Ms. Applewhite earned her master's degree from Baylor College of Medicine in Houston, Texas. She was employed by Pfizer Pharmaceutical in New York City as a physician assistant for many years.

Ms. Applewhite was a member of the Achilles Track Club, which she represented in several New York marathons, a Marine Corps marathon, as well as many other races. She participated in the Patient-to-Patient volunteer group and the Cancer Survivor Group at Memorial Sloan-Kettering Cancer Center and Outward Bound.

Ms. Applewhite was the beloved wife of Mamadou Kone; loving daughter of Mary Davis Applewhite, of Manassas, Virginia and the late Harris McLain Applewhite and dear sister of John Applewhite of New York City and Margaret Smith of Manassas, Virginia. She is also survived by six nieces and nephews.
